This 20-minute Easy Shrimp and Leek Frittata is my busy-day lifesaver! Just 5 ingredients, one pan, and zero fuss—perfect for gluten-free or keto mornings. Watch the video below!

🍤 Serves 4 | 🥚 High-Protein | 🌿 Gluten-Free | ⏱ 20-Min Meal
Mornings don’t have to mean boring breakfasts! This Shrimp and Leek Frittata is my 20-minute savior—packed with protein, cooked in one pan, and naturally gluten-free. Perfect for busy days when you want delicious without the fuss.
Love this One-Pan Prawn and Leek Frittata? Try my easy crustless spinach quiche recipe for a low-carb brunch, or steamed oil-free omelette for weight loss when you want something light. Serve slices with high-protein white bean dip without tahini and 30-minute no-knead focaccia for beginners for a crowd-pleasing spread!
Jump to:
💭 Expert Tip
If you’re short on time, prep the leeks and shrimp the night before. In the morning you will be so grateful.
💗 Why You’ll Love This Recipe
✅ Quick – Ready faster than waiting in a coffee line (20 minutes).
✅ Protein-packed – Keeps you full until lunch. Craving more shrimp? This pesto shrimp gnocchi is another 20-minute wonder!
✅ Easy cleanup – Just one pan is needed.
✅ Gluten-free & keto-friendly
🥘Ingredients
*See the recipe card for full information on ingredients and quantities.
- Leeks (white/light green parts only): I always go for firm, straight leeks with bright white bases—those tough dark green tops? I save them for stock.
- Raw shrimp (peeled): I prefer wild-caught for a sweeter taste. If you're using frozen, thaw them overnight in the fridge—never in the microwave! Shrimp doneness test: Curls into a "C" shape? Perfectly cooked.
- Eggs: They blend better when they’re at room temperature, especially with cream cheese. I like organic or free-range eggs for richer yolks. For silkier eggs, whisk in 1 tablespoon water per egg.
- Cream cheese: Full-fat gives the best texture, but if you want something lighter, low-fat works too. Flavored ones like garlic and herb? A nice shortcut for extra depth. Hack: Microwave for 10 seconds to soften.
- Cherry tomatoes: Vine-ripened are best—they’re naturally sweeter.
- (Ingredient quality directly impacts the final dish—every choice matters!)
♻️ Substitutions
- Cream cheese → Goat cheese or feta (for tanginess).
- No leeks? Use onions or spinach (you'll get a different but equally tasty onion frittata).
- Spring Ingredient Swaps: Use asparagus instead of leeks in April!
- Shrimp alternatives: Chicken or sausage work in this leek frittata base.
- Cherry Tomatoes: Sun-dried tomatoes (oil-packed, chopped).
📋 Variations
Spicy Leek Frittata – Add red pepper flakes.
Triple-Cheese Leek Frittata – Mix parmesan and cheddar into the eggs.
👩🍳 How to Make Easy Shrimp and Leek Frittata
These photos reveal exactly what to look for at each stage – from fluffy eggs to caramelized leeks. For more quick one-pan breakfast inspiration, try our roasted pepper baked eggs (ready in 20 minutes!) or easy cabbage frittata (packed with veggies).
Step 1: Gently crack 5 eggs into a mixing bowl. Pro tip: Use the counter, not the bowl edge, for cleaner breaks!
Step 2: Whisk vigorously for 45 seconds until pale and frothy. Those bubbles = extra-fluffy texture later!
Step 3: Add cream cheese straight to the bowl. No need to premix - those lumps melt into creamy pockets!
Step 4: Stir just until combined. Small cheese streaks are perfect - they'll create rich swirls in the cooked frittata.
Step 5: Cook sliced leeks in olive oil for 5 minutes until softened and fragrant. They'll turn slightly translucent when ready.
Step 6: Pour eggs over filling, dot with remaining cream cheese, and nestle tomato halves cut-side up.
Step 7: Let cook undisturbed for 5-8 minutes until edges pull away from the pan (center will still jiggle).
Step 8: Broil 2-3 minutes until the top blisters and gets spotty brown. A slight wobble means it's perfectly done!
Pro Tip: For extra lift, whisk 1 tablespoon water into eggs - it creates steam pockets under the broiler! No broiler? Cover with lid last 2 minutes to set the top.
🥗 Serving Suggestions
- With a side of avocado slices or mixed greens.
- Drizzle with hot sauce or garlic aioli.
- Mixed greens with lemon vinaigrette or my sautéed green beans with garlic.
- Roasted cherry tomatoes or my Şakşuka (Turkish fried vegetables)
- Avocado slices
- Crusty bread (for non-low-carb versions) like my soft white dinner buns or this 3-ingredient no-knead bread.
❓ Easy Shrimp and Leek Frittata Recipe FAQs
Yes! Thaw frozen shrimp overnight in the fridge, then pat them dry before cooking. This prevents excess moisture in your Prawn and Leek Frittata. For best results, use large shrimp (31/40 count) - they stay juicier in this 20-minute high-protein breakfast recipe.
The secret is whisking eggs with cream cheese (our cream cheese frittata trick!) and baking just until set. Overcooking makes eggs rubbery. For extra fluff in your shrimp and leek frittata, add a splash of milk or water when beating the eggs.
This savory breakfast frittata pairs perfectly with:
• Mixed greens with lemon vinaigrette or my sautéed green beans with garlic.
• Roasted cherry tomatoes or my Şakşuka (Turkish fried vegetables)
• Avocado slices
• Crusty bread (for non-low-carb versions) like my soft white dinner buns or this 3-ingredient no-knead bread.
Common fixes for your Leek Frittata:
- Squeeze excess moisture from cooked leeks.
- Pat shrimp dry before adding.
- Cook uncovered the last 2 minutes.
- Let rest 5 minutes before slicing.
Absolutely! This quick frittata recipe stores beautifully:
• Refrigerate for 3 days
• Freeze slices for 1 month
• Reheat in a 350°F oven for 10 minutes (this keeps the Italian herb shrimp and leek frittata texture perfect)
More Fast & Tasty Egg Breakfasts
Tried this recipe? Give it a star rating below! ⭐⭐⭐⭐⭐
HUNGRY FOR MORE? Subscribe to my newsletter and follow along on Facebook, Pinterest, and Instagram for the latest updates.
Ieva says
Great simple recipe. Love the sweetness of the leeks. Had it for lunch with a big green salad and It was lovely 🙂
Chelsea says
Just made this for breakfast for our crew and it was delicious! The combo of shrimp, and cherry tomatoes was perfect!
Cornelia says
This shrimp and leek frittata looks amazing! Such a great combination of flavors—light, savory, and perfect for any meal. Definitely going to try this easy recipe soon!
Andrea says
This frittata came out light and flavorful—definitely going into our weekday breakfast rotation.
Criss says
This worked exactly as written, thanks!
Swathi says
I agree with you this shrimp and leek frittata is so yummy . Perfect breakfast idea.
Juyali says
Had this for breakfast and it was quick to make, super satisfying, and barely any cleanup—definitely keeping this in the rotation.
Nicole Kendrick says
This worked exactly as written, thanks!
Nora says
This Easy Shrimp and Leek Frittata is such a lifesaver on busy mornings! It’s light, flavorful, and comes together so quickly with just a handful of ingredients. The combo of tender shrimp and sweet leeks is absolutely delicious—definitely keeping this one in my regular breakfast rotation!
Razvan C says
Thank you for sharing this recipe!
Liz says
I love a fritatta for breakfast and this was delicious!! The combination of shrimp and leeks was outstanding.
Cristina says
My family loved this!